DisplayBuddy is a macOS utility that lets you adjust brightness, contrast, and volume on external displays straight from the menu bar, using DDC/CI over the existing video cable — no extra hardware required. It handles Apple Studio Display and most third-party monitors, supports global hotkeys, and reacts to ambient light if you want auto-brightness for non-Apple panels.
The app is a paid macOS download with a free trial, made by an indie team that publishes a blog and direct comparison pages against BetterDisplay, Lunar, Dell Display Manager and LG OnScreen. It's been covered by 9to5Mac and MakeUseOf, so the external footprint is real rather than SEO chatter.
